		<description><![CDATA[Eskinder Nega was arrested after raising questions about arrests under Ethiopia&#8217;s anti-terrorism legislation in September 2011. Now he serves an 18 year sentence thanks to the very law he questioned. &#8220;The Ethiopian government is treating calls for peaceful protest as a terrorist act and is outlawing the legitimate activity of journalists and opposition members,&#8221; said Amnesty International&#8216;s &#8230; <a href="http://www.humanosphere.org/2013/05/if-a-journalists-is-arrested-in-ethiopia-and-jailed-for-18-years-does-he-make-a-sound/">Continue reading <span class="meta-nav">&#8594;</span></a>]]></description>

		<description><![CDATA[To be a poor woman with an unwanted pregnancy in El Salvador is to be at the convergence of misfortune. Abortion has been entirely illegal in El Salvador, without exception, since 1998. Such bans do not result in fewer abortions, of course, just more clandestine and unsafe procedures. <a href="http://www.humanosphere.org/2013/04/life-saving-abortion-case-in-el-salvador/">Continue reading <span class="meta-nav">&#8594;</span></a>]]></description>
